What is the "normal" Ovary Size?

I've done some research on the normal ovary size for different age group.

http://www.sciencedirect.com/science?_ob=ArticleURL&_udi=B6WG6-45F4NJG-7D&_user=10&_coverDate=06%2F30%2F2000&_rdoc=1&_fmt=high&_orig=search&_sort=d&_docanchor=&view=c&_searchStrId=1329560796&_rerunOrigin=google&_acct=C000050221&_version=1&_urlVersion=0&_userid=10&md5=8972ce6cded5761cf21e490ca0d2b09d

Abstract


Objective. The goal of this study was to determine the relationship of ovarian volume to age, height, and weight in women undergoing transvaginal sonography.

Methods. Thirteen thousand nine hundred sixty-three women 25–91 years of age undergoing annual transvaginal sonography as part of the University of Kentucky Ovarian Cancer Screening Program were the subjects for this investigation. Each ovary was measured in three dimensions, and ovarian volume was calculated using the prolate ellipsoid formula (L × H × W × 0.523). Mean ovarian volume according to age was calculated for each decade of life.

Results. Data were obtained from 58,673 observations of ovarian volume. Mean ovarian volume was 6.6 ± 0.19 cm3 in women less than 30 years of age; 6.1 ± 0.06 cm3 in women 30–39; 4.8 ± 0.03 cm3 in women 40–49; 2.6 ± 0.01 cm3 in women 50–59; 2.1 ± 0.01 cm3 in women 60–69; and 1.8 ± 0.08 cm3 in women ≥70. Mean ovarian volume was 4.9 ± 0.03 cm3 in premenopausal women and 2.2 ± 0.01 cm3 in postmenopausal women (P < 0.001). The use of exogenous estrogens was associated with a significant reduction in ovarian volume in women 40–59 years of age, but not in women ≥ 60. Ovarian volume was unrelated to patient weight but was greater in tall women (>68 in.) than in short women (<58 in.).

Conclusion. There is a statistically significant decrease in ovarian volume with each decade of life from age 30 to age 70. Mean ovarian volume in premenopausal women is significantly greater than that in postmenopausal women. The upper limit of normal for ovarian volume is 20 cm3 in premenopausal women and 10 cm3 in postmenopausal women.

The Qingming Festival (simplified Chinese: 清明节) Clear Bright Festival, Ancestors Day or Tomb Sweeping Day is a traditional Chinese festival on the 104th day after the winter solstice (or the 15th day from the Spring Equinox), usually occurring around April 5 of the Gregorian calendar (see Chinese calendar).

The Qingming festival falls on the first day of the fifth solar term, named Qingming. Its name denotes a time for people to go outside and enjoy the greenery of springtime (踏青 Tàqīng, "treading on the greenery") and tend to the graves of departed ones.


Qingming has been regularly observed as a statutory public holiday in Taiwan and in the Chinese jurisdictions of Hong Kong and Macau. Its observance was reinstated as a public holiday in mainland China in 2008, after having been previously suppressed by the ruling Communist Party in 1949.

Gonal-f RFF Pen Solution


All medicines may cause side effects, but many people have no, or minor, side effects. Check with your doctor if any of these most COMMON side effects persist or become bothersome when using Gonal-f RFF Pen Solution:

Breast pain; discomfort, pain, or mild bruising at the injection site; headache; mild stomach pain or nausea; sinus inflammation; sore throat; stuffy nose.

Seek medical attention right away if any of these SEVERE side effects occur when using Gonal-f RFF Pen Solution:

Severe allergic reactions (rash; hives; itching; difficulty breathing; tightness in the chest; swelling of the mouth, face, lips, or tongue); abnormal vaginal bleeding; calf pain or tenderness; chest pain; confusion; decreased urination; diarrhea; fever; one-sided weakness; severe or persistent stomach pain, upset, or bloating; severe or persistent nausea; severe pelvic or back pain; shortness of breath; slurred speech; sudden, unexplained weight gain; unusual vaginal itching, discharge, or odor; vision changes; vomitting.

Egg white is the common name for the clear liquid (also called the albumen or the glair/glaire) contained within an egg. It is the cytoplasm of the egg, which until fertilization is a single cell (including the yolk). It consists mainly of about 15% proteins dissolved in water. Its primary natural purpose is to protect the egg yolk and provide additional nutrition for the growth of the embryo, as it is rich in proteins and also of high nutritional value. Unlike the egg yolk, it contains a negligible amount of fat. Egg whites have many culinary and non-culinary uses for humans

The egg white is approximately two-thirds of the total egg's weight out of its shell with nearly 90% of that weight coming from water. The remaining weight of the egg white comes from protein, trace minerals, fatty material, vitamins, and glucose.[1] The U.S. large egg's white weighs 38 grams with 4.7 grams of protein, 0.3 grams of carbohydrate and 62 milligrams of sodium. The U.S. large egg white contains about 20 calories.[2] Egg white has no dietary cholesterol. Egg white contains approximately 40 different proteins.[3] Below is a list of the proteins found in egg whites by percentage along with their natural functions.[1][4]




54% Ovalbumin - Nourishment; blocks digestive enzymes

12% Ovotransferrin - Binds iron

11% Ovomucoid - Blocks digestive enzymes

4% Ovoglobulin G2

4% Ovoglobulin G3

3.5% Ovomucin

3.4% Lysozyme

1.5% Ovoinhibitor

1% Ovoglycoprotein

0.8% Flavoprotein

0.5% Ovomacroglobulin

0.5% Avidin

0.05% Cystatin

Although egg whites are prized as a source of low-fat, high-protein nutrition, a small number of people cannot eat them. Egg allergy is more common among infants than adults, and most children will outgrow it by the age of five.[16] Allergic reactions against egg white are more common than reactions against egg yolks.[17] In addition to true allergic reactions, some people experience a food intolerance to egg whites.[

Common Side Effects


Approximately 52 percent of lucrin users report hot flashes, making this the most common side effect of the drug. The retention of fluid under the skin is also common, occurring in at least 8 percent of users. More than 5 percent of patients who take lucrin experience dizziness, pain throughout the body, headache, nausea and vomiting.

Other Side Effects

Lucrin also has the potential to cause a number of other troublesome or annoying, but not dangerous, side effects. Some patients experience gastrointestinal side effects from the drug, such as diarrhea and loss of appetite. Nervous system effects like anxiety, tingling in the extremities, forgetfulness, sour taste and insomnia as well as fever and fatigue are also possible while taking lucrin. Other possible side effects of lucrin include breast tenderness in women and impotence in men.

Allergic Reaction

Though rare, lucrin has the potential to cause serious allergic reactions in some patients. The first signs of an allergic reaction are often the formation of hives anywhere on the body and itching around the mouth and lips. Without medical attention, the reaction often progresses to more dangerous symptoms, such as swelling of the lips and throat or difficulty breathing. If you experience any signs of an allergic reaction at any point while using lucrin, seek prompt emergency medical care.

Risks

In addition to minor side effects and the risk of interactions, lucrin has the potential to cause serious medical complications. In some cases, lucrin has been linked to cardiovascular problems, including the formation of blood clots, inflammation of veins, heart attack and irregular heartbeat. Lucrin sometimes causes difficulty and irregular breathing as well as gastrointestinal bleeding. Serious neuro-sensory effects of lucrin include blurred vision and numbness.

Considerations

In some cases, lucrin injections cause an initial worsening of the symptoms of the illness or disease. Doctors also limit the use of lucrin in patients who have impaired kidneys as without proper urination, levels of the drug can build up in the body and become toxic. Lucrin is not typically prescribed to treat children as there is not enough information to ensure that pediatric usage does not lead to long term side effects. Lucrin injections may cause damage to the fetus and typically are avoided during pregnancy.

Why Birth Control Pills (BCP) prior to IVF?

Have you wonder why BCP is usually given in the IVF long protocol?

I've done some research and found an answer there:
http://100infertilityquestions.blogspot.com/2008/01/birth-control-pills-and-ivf-protocols.html

First, in patients who are known or suspected to be high responders, OCPs may help mitigate the risk of ovarian hyperstimulation syndrome

Second, in patients without predictable regular menstrual cycles, OCPs can be used in combination with Lupron to initiate an IVF cycle.

Third, some clinics use OCPs for microdose Lupron (MDL) flare, traditional flare, or patients who are taking Antagon in the hope that pretreatment with OCPs will prevent one follicle from growing faster than the other follicles once the stimulation has begun.

Given that prolonged OCP use can lead to oversuppression in low responders, it has to be used very carefully.

KKH IVF Clinic

The clinic I'm receiving fertility treatment is KKH and have been with them since 2007 and my Dr is - Dr SF Loh.

I don't think this clinic offers excellent service but I stay with them since I managed to get pregnant thrice under Dr SF Loh, so I'm hoping for a 4th miracle and this time to have a successful pregnancy and delivery of my baby (babies).

I will be on lucrin for almost 21 days, in addition to Puregon for up to16 days. 
Once my lining and folicles size and qty is right, I'll be on this HCG jab to triger ovulation for ER (Egg Retriever) and 2 days later will be ET (Embryo Transfer).
Subject to my progesterone level, I may need more progesterone jabs.

The actual schedule as follows:
Day 1 : start of menses - call KKH IVF
Day 2 - Day 16 : Microgyon (birth control pills) x 16 days
Day 16 - Day 21 : Microgyon 5 days + subcut Lucrin 10 units x 5 days Total Microgyon 21 days
Day 21 - Day 30 : subcut Lucrin 10 Units 9 days Total 14 days Lucrin
- baseline scan & bloodtest for E2
Day 31 - Day 37 : subcut Lucrin 10 units x another 7 days
Day 38 - Day 44 : subcut Puregon 200 IU x 7 days + Lucrin 10 units
Day 45 (8th day of puregon)- Day 53 (16th day of puregon): subcut Puregon + Lucrin 10 units (dosage depends on growth of follicles) - 1st scan on 8th day of puregon; 2nd scan betwen 9th -12th days; 3rd scan between 13th - 15th day. When follicles reach 16mm, STOP Lucrin. Total 16 days puregon
Day 54 : IM pregnyl at night , ER 2 days later
Day 56 : Egg Retrieval
Day 57 - Day 58 : wait for fertilisation
Day 59 : Egg transfer
/ balance embroyo to freeze
Day 60 - Day 76 - return for progesterone blood tests (x3) - if more than 15 eggs collected, got to return for IM progesterone daily for 17 days. If less than 15 eggs collected, 4 x HCG jabs.
Day 77
: 17 days later, pregnancy test
